Overview of the Dell S2722DGM

The Dell S2722DGM is a 27-inch gaming monitor with a 2560×1440 resolution, often mistaken for 4K but actually offering Quad HD clarity. It features a fast 165Hz refresh rate, a 1ms response time, and AMD FreeSync support. Its design emphasizes performance, making it popular among gamers and content creators alike.

Key Features of Dell S2722DGM

  • 27-inch display with a 2560×1440 resolution
  • 165Hz refresh rate for smooth visuals
  • 1ms response time for fast action
  • AMD FreeSync technology
  • IPS panel for accurate colors
  • Adjustable stand for ergonomic comfort

Competitors in the 4K Content Market

While the Dell S2722DGM excels in high refresh rate gaming, it does not natively support 4K resolution. For true 4K content, other monitors are designed specifically for that purpose. Key competitors include models like the LG 27UN880-B, ASUS ProArt PA278CV, and Samsung U28R550.

Comparison with 4K Monitors

LG 27UN880-B

The LG 27UN880-B offers a 27-inch 4K UHD display with excellent color accuracy and HDR support. It is ideal for professional content creation and media consumption. Its ergonomic stand and USB-C connectivity add to its versatility.

ASUS ProArt PA278CV

Samsung U28R550

The Samsung U28R550 is a 28-inch 4K UHD monitor with good color performance and a sleek design. It is suitable for general use, including gaming, media, and productivity, with HDMI and DisplayPort support.

Which Is Better for 4K Content?

If your primary focus is true 4K content, the LG 27UN880-B or Samsung U28R550 are better choices due to their native 4K resolution and color capabilities. The Dell S2722DGM is excellent for high-refresh-rate gaming but does not support 4K natively.
